Risotto Not Getting Soft. Even perfectly cooked arborio will tend to be relatively soft. 10 mistakes to avoid when making risotto. Make sure the rice is cooked just right, soft but still slightly firm in the center. Simply put, if you add all the stock at once, your rice will get way too soft, too quickly, and your risotto will resemble porridge. Instead of making this grave mistake, add your stock a little at a time. Risotto can be tricky, but don't let it intimidate you.
